powerup system

This commit is contained in:
zoe 2021-10-05 21:55:34 +02:00
parent c8747328cf
commit 77ca16be36
149 changed files with 2472 additions and 331 deletions

View file

@ -8,4 +8,5 @@ func _ready():
$AnimationPlayer.play("FadeOut")
func finish_animation():
get_tree().paused = false
var _new_scene = get_tree().change_scene(scene_to_load)

View file

@ -5,6 +5,7 @@
[ext_resource path="res://SFX/Scratch/Fadeout.ogg" type="AudioStream" id=3]
[node name="FadeOut" instance=ExtResource( 1 )]
pause_mode = 2
script = ExtResource( 2 )
[node name="FadeoutSound" type="AudioStreamPlayer" parent="AnimationPlayer" index="0"]

4
Effects/Floppy.gd Normal file
View file

@ -0,0 +1,4 @@
extends CanvasLayer
func _ready():
$AnimationPlayer.play("Saving")

44
Effects/Floppy.tscn Normal file
View file

@ -0,0 +1,44 @@
[gd_scene load_steps=4 format=2]
[ext_resource path="res://Menu/Icons/Floppy/Floppy.png" type="Texture" id=1]
[ext_resource path="res://Effects/Floppy.gd" type="Script" id=2]
[sub_resource type="Animation" id=1]
resource_name = "Saving"
tracks/0/type = "value"
tracks/0/path = NodePath("Sprite:position")
tracks/0/interp = 1
tracks/0/loop_wrap = true
tracks/0/imported = false
tracks/0/enabled = true
tracks/0/keys = {
"times": PoolRealArray( 0, 0.1, 0.9, 1 ),
"transitions": PoolRealArray( 1, 1, 1, 1 ),
"update": 0,
"values": [ Vector2( 374, -10 ), Vector2( 374, 10 ), Vector2( 374, 10 ), Vector2( 374, -8 ) ]
}
tracks/1/type = "method"
tracks/1/path = NodePath(".")
tracks/1/interp = 1
tracks/1/loop_wrap = true
tracks/1/imported = false
tracks/1/enabled = true
tracks/1/keys = {
"times": PoolRealArray( 1 ),
"transitions": PoolRealArray( 1 ),
"values": [ {
"args": [ ],
"method": "queue_free"
} ]
}
[node name="Floppy" type="CanvasLayer"]
pause_mode = 2
script = ExtResource( 2 )
[node name="Sprite" type="Sprite" parent="."]
position = Vector2( 374, -10 )
texture = ExtResource( 1 )
[node name="AnimationPlayer" type="AnimationPlayer" parent="."]
anims/Saving = SubResource( 1 )